花费 40 ms
[C#进阶系列]专题一:深入解析深拷贝和浅拷贝

一、前言   这个星期参加了一个面试,面试中问到深浅拷贝的区别,然后我就简单了讲述了它们的之间的区别,然后面试官又继续问,如何实现一个深拷贝呢?当时只回答回答了一种方式,就是使用反射,然后面试官提示 ...

Sun Mar 29 00:01:00 CST 2015 10 12892
【C#进阶系列】03 配置文件管理与程序集的引用版本重定向

先来点与标题不相关的: CLR支持两种程序集:弱命名程序集和强命名程序集。 两者的区别在于强命名程序集使用发布者的公钥和私钥进行签名。由于程序集被唯一性地标识,所以当应用程序绑定到强命名程序集时, ...

Wed Mar 02 07:56:00 CST 2016 0 2340
【C#进阶系列】15 枚举类型和位标志

实际上本章就只讲枚举类型,因为位标志本来就可以当做一个特殊的枚举类型。 关于枚举类型 枚举类型是一种消灭魔法数字的好方法,使程序更容易编写,阅读和维护。 枚举类型是值类型,然而有别于其它值类型, ...

Thu Mar 24 07:13:00 CST 2016 0 2032
【C#进阶系列】30 学习总结

前面学起来还是很顺的,毕竟很多都接触过。 后面学起来只能用“磨”来形容,以至于八章用了2个月。(当然也有相当一些原因是这两个月中发生了一些个人生活上的问题) 总的来说收获超大,这种感觉就像大一的时 ...

Wed Jun 01 07:45:00 CST 2016 5 941
【C#进阶系列】23 程序集加载和反射

程序集加载 程序集加载,CLR使用System.Reflection.Assembly.Load静态方法,当然这个方法我们自己也可以显式调用。 还有一个Assembly.LoadFrom方法加载指 ...

Fri Apr 22 06:43:00 CST 2016 0 1684

 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M